About Irène Zbinden

Irène Zbinden is a scholar working on Aging, Nutrition and Dietetics and Biochemistry, having authored 16 papers that have together received 577 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Diet and metabolism studies (3 papers), DNA Repair Mechanisms (2 papers) and Clinical Nutrition and Gastroenterology (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Nutrition and Dietetics (92 citations), Biochemistry (33 citations) and Cancer Research (67 citations). Irène Zbinden has collaborated with scholars based in Switzerland, France and Spain. Frequent co-authors include P Cerutti, Rémy Moret, Paul Amstad, Alexander V. Peskin, Girish M. Shah, Katherine Macé, Rudolf Leuchtenberger, Julie Moulin, Dana R. Crawford and Christian Darimont. Their work appears in journals such as Nature, Journal of Clinical Oncology and S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ología.
